" Dough, Ray, and Me " is the (Episode 8) of the animated spy comedy Archer , which originally aired on October 12, 2022 . The episode serves as a significant turning point for the series, resolving the season-long conflict with the International Intelligence Agency (IIA) and establishing a new leadership dynamic for the main cast. 🎭 Episode Synopsis
